Description:
Explore a comprehensive analysis of the geopolitical tensions surrounding the Korean Peninsula in this World Economic Forum panel discussion. Delve into North Korea's nuclear weapons development and its impact on regional stability. Examine interactive maps and data to understand the strategic context of this crisis. Learn from insights shared by international experts, including Ashton B. Carter, Kang Kyung-Wha, and Su Ge, as they discuss potential avenues for addressing the challenges and averting conflict. Moderated by Kishore Mahbubani, the panel covers topics such as sanctions effectiveness, China's role, diplomatic relations, and the possibility of peaceful resolutions. Gain a deeper understanding of the complex dynamics at play and the various approaches being considered by regional and international leaders to defuse tensions on the Korean Peninsula.
